Diversity & Demographics FAQs for US ZIP Code 44012

The largest racial or ethnic group in US ZIP Code 44012 is White (Non-Hispanic), which makes up 91.1% of the total population.

Since 2021, the diversity index for US ZIP Code 44012 has remained stable. The area currently has a diversity score of 16.8/100, which is considered a Low level of diversity.
